Attorneys for Asbestos Exposure

Asbestos was widely used construction materials in the 1930s and into the 1970s. It was used in insulation for pipes, fireproofing products, plasters and cements, car brakes and much more. Exposure to this dangerous mineral can lead to a variety of severe medical conditions, including mesothelioma as well as other respiratory illnesses.

A licensed New York mesothelioma lawyer can assist victims to seek compensation from the companies responsible for their exposure. It is crucial to select the right attorney for filing this kind of claim.

Find a Specialist

Asbest fibers are inhaled when they are extracted and processed. This can cause asbestosis, lung cancer and mesothelioma. People who are exposed to the mineral face higher chance of being exposed than other, but even those who do not handle it directly can breathe it in. This type of exposure is called secondary exposure and it can affect anyone who is near the worker's contaminated clothing or equipment. This includes relatives who wash the worker's uniform and those who live in the same house. This can also happen in military bases and on ships where crew members wear the same uniforms for long periods of time.

Asbestos can be a problem for those who work in shipyards, construction and mills and also in mining, insulation and other industries. This was particularly true in the United States from the 1950s to the 1990s. Workers could be exposed to it when old buildings were demolished or remodeled, and when construction materials were damaged. Even today, demolition and remodeling in older buildings can release asbestos into the air.

It could be a long time between exposure to asbestos and the beginning of mesothelioma or other signs. It is therefore essential to consult a physician when you've been exposed to asbestos or think you may be suffering from any of the ailments that are associated with it.

Your doctor will take a listen to your lungs and ask about any past work that might have involved asbestos. If they suspect that you suffer from an asbestos-related illness, they will likely send you to a specialist for additional tests. Chest X-rays, CT scans, and pulmonary function tests can all detect asbestos legal-related illnesses, but they do not always appear on these tests.

These diseases can manifest in the lungs, stomach (abdomen) and heart. It is extremely rare that mesothelioma develops in the brain.

Report Your Suspicion to Your Employer

Asbestos is a fibrous substance used in many industrial applications because of its resistance to heat as well as its flexibility and strength. However, asbestos can cause serious health issues like mesothelioma or lung cancer. These conditions are painful, debilitating, and sometimes fatal. Anyone who has been exposed to asbestos may be entitled to compensation. A successful lawsuit can cover medical bills, lost wages, home care costs, and much more.

Workers who have been exposed to asbestos should notify anyone who is showing signs of illness right away. This is especially important for construction workers, who are frequently exposed asbestos when renovating old structures. These structures were constructed before asbestos was identified as a carcinogen that could cause harm and could contain unsafe levels of the material.

Exposure to asbestos can lead to numerous illnesses, and the symptoms of these illnesses typically do not appear for 25 to 50 years after the exposure. Anyone who has been exposed should visit their physician regularly for health checks. This is the best method to avoid the development of asbestos-related diseases or to recognize early warning symptoms.

Certain people are more at risk for asbestos exposure than others. For instance, Navy veterans may have been exposed to asbestos while serving on ships and in other military facilities. Asbestos is also found in those who work with shipyards as well as heating systems, construction or automotive industries.

Numerous agencies have rules and regulations that employers must follow when it comes to asbestos in the workplace. If you suspect that your employer is not following the guidelines and regulations, you can contact the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) for more information or an inspection.

Furthermore, certain veterans who have served in the United States Armed Forces may be qualified for disability compensation. Veterans who are eligible can file claims for benefits due to asbestos exposure while serving with the VA.

Claim Your Claim

Your attorney will compile your health history and employment records to create an outline of your asbestos exposure. Then, they'll build your case by assembling evidence that proves that you were exposed to asbestos and that the exposure caused harm. The complaint will be sent to all defendants and they will have 30 days in which to respond. The defendants typically deny responsibility and may attempt to blame someone else. You need a seasoned team of lawyers to tackle these denials.

Once they have all the required documents Your attorney will file your asbestos lawsuit. They will file it in the state court system that best suits your situation. During this time period, the attorneys will collect evidence and conduct discovery, in which they share information about the case with the opposing side.
